redis-cli如何使用密码

fiy 其他 73

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    使用redis-cli命令行工具连接带有密码的Redis服务器的操作如下:

    1. 打开终端,输入以下命令启动redis-cli:
    redis-cli
    
    1. 如果Redis服务器已经设置了密码,且开启了密码验证功能,那么在执行命令之前需要先进行身份验证。使用以下命令进行身份验证:
    AUTH password
    

    这里的password是Redis服务器设置的密码,将其替换为实际的密码。如果密码正确,将返回"OK"表示身份验证成功。

    1. 身份验证成功后,即可执行其他操作。例如,可以使用以下命令来查看所有的键:
    KEYS *
    
    1. 其他常用的操作还包括设置键值对、获取值、删除键等等。例如,可以使用以下命令来设置一个键值对:
    SET key value
    

    其中,key是要设置的键,value是要设置的值。

    1. 使用完毕后,可以使用以下命令来关闭redis-cli:
    QUIT
    

    这样就完成了使用redis-cli连接带有密码的Redis服务器的操作。需要注意的是,为了数据安全,建议设置强密码并定期更换密码,以避免未授权访问。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要在redis-cli中使用密码,需要进行以下步骤:

    1. 启动redis-cli:在终端中输入“redis-cli”并按回车,即可启动redis-cli。

    2. 连接到Redis服务器:在启动redis-cli时,可以通过添加参数来指定连接到的Redis服务器的IP地址和端口号。例如,要连接到本地主机上的默认Redis服务器(即IP地址为127.0.0.1,端口号为6379),可以使用以下命令:

    redis-cli -h 127.0.0.1 -p 6379
    

    请根据实际情况替换IP地址和端口号。

    1. 输入密码:如果Redis服务器已启用密码验证,则在连接到服务器后,需要输入密码才能进行操作。在redis-cli中,可以使用“AUTH”命令来输入密码。例如,如果密码是“password”,可以使用以下命令进行验证:
    AUTH password
    

    请将“password”替换为实际使用的密码。

    1. 执行操作:在成功验证密码后,就可以在redis-cli中执行各种操作了。例如,可以使用“SET”命令设置键值对:
    SET key value
    

    请将“key”和“value”替换为实际使用的键和值。

    1. 退出redis-cli:在完成所有操作后,可以使用“QUIT”命令退出redis-cli:
    QUIT
    

    通过执行上述步骤,您就可以在redis-cli中使用密码进行操作。请确保输入的密码正确,并且已启用密码验证功能。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Redis-cli是Redis自带的一个命令行工具,用于与Redis服务器进行交互。如果Redis服务器启用了密码验证,则我们需要在使用redis-cli时提供密码。

    下面是使用redis-cli连接带有密码验证的Redis服务器的步骤:

    1. 在终端或命令行窗口中运行以下命令启动redis-cli:

      redis-cli
      
    2. 连接到Redis服务器:

      redis-cli -h <host> -p <port>
      

      <host>是Redis服务器的主机名或IP地址,<port>是Redis服务器的端口号(默认为6379)。例如,连接到本地主机上的Redis服务器可以使用以下命令:

      redis-cli -h 127.0.0.1 -p 6379
      
    3. 输入密码:

      如果Redis服务器启用了密码验证,当连接到服务器后,redis-cli会要求输入密码。在提示符下输入密码并按下回车键。

      redis-cli -h <host> -p <port>
      
      > AUTH <password>
      

      这里 <password>是Redis服务器的密码。

      如果密码验证成功,redis-cli会显示消息“OK”。如果密码验证失败,redis-cli会显示错误消息并关闭连接。

    4. 初次连接设置密码:

      如果是首次连接Redis服务器并设置密码,则需要在redis.conf配置文件中设置密码。

      打开redis.conf文件:

      sudo vi /etc/redis/redis.conf
      

      在文件中找到并取消注释配置项requirepass

      requirepass <password>
      

      <password>是你想要设置的密码。

      保存并退出文件。然后,重启Redis服务器:

      sudo service redis restart
      

      然后,在使用redis-cli连接时进行密码验证的步骤中输入这个密码。

    这样,你就可以在Redis服务器启用密码验证后使用redis-cli了。请注意,密码验证是保护Redis服务器安全的重要措施之一,请确保密码强度足够,并定期更改密码以提高安全性。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部